Role Profile

We have an exciting opportunity in the Finance Department within our Corporate Services Directorate.

The Corporate Services Directorate is responsible for the overall governance of the SEAI and includes Finance, Inspections, Governance and Procurement, Legal, Marketing and Communications, HR \& OD and ICT.

The Finance Team plays a key role in the organisation by tracking performance and enabling organisation decision making at senior management level. We develop and track progress against business plans and engage and inform a range of key internal and external stakeholders on all key issues facing SEAI.

The Finance Team promotes, informs, and implements process and operational improvements that aim to create a more efficient and effective organisation. The Team is responsible for the effective use of SEAI's budget and have systems in place to track, analyse and challenge all areas of the business to ensure high quality outcomes.

Working as part of the Corporate Services team, the Finance Business Partner will have reach and visibility across the whole organisation, gathering, analysing, and understanding financial and non\-financial data, inputting into business and programme decisions.

The Finance Business Partner will play a crucial role in supporting programme teams in achieving objectives. This role will provide key support to various activities such as financial and risk analysis, forecasting, planning, and business case development.

Reporting to the Head of Finance, the role is key to adding value to the work of the Finance Team and the wider organisation and will enable and influence effective decision making at a senior management level. The successful candidate will join an enthusiastic and innovative team who are committed to the high\-quality delivery of SEAI's goals.

Essential Requirements

The successful candidate must be able to demonstrate:

  • An ordinary degree (Level 7 on the NFQ or greater) or equivalent professional qualification in Business, Finance, or a related discipline.

  • Fully qualified accountant with membership of a prescribed accountancy body (e.g. ACA, ACCA, CPA, CIMA) in Accountancy.

  • A minimum of six years' post qualification experience.

  • Experience working as part of a Finance function in a relevant industry or similar environment including:

  • Experience working with and ensuring compliance with financial controls and procedures.

  • Experience of managing a team and staff development.

  • Proven experience in delivering programmes analysis.

  • Experience in managing projects involving a diverse range of internal and external stakeholders.

  • Strong systems experience including:

  • Experience building and managing strong internal controls and governance.

Desirable Requirements


  • Knowledge of Integra / Centros Financial System.

  • Knowledge / Experience of working in the Public Sector.

  • Knowledge of Power BI reporting and data analytics.

  • Experience of change management.

  • Experience or knowledge of delivering positive customer experiences.

  • Proficient in the Irish language.
